Output e2000ae2ea8440a2006c6d43f236888b6e462cd23a3ea84b5c83d76ff84c7e29:1

value
700000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db245e073dc1321c4caf17a3407fd06a4e241b0a OP_EQUAL
address
3MfjUQ5kBW5fmSCqiou7Qwh9BDsnC19TyX
transaction
e2000ae2ea8440a2006c6d43f236888b6e462cd23a3ea84b5c83d76ff84c7e29
confirmations
255502
spent
true